technical field
[0001] The invention is applied to the production of organic crops, can improve the structure of soil, provide sufficient water, oxygen and nutrients, and improve the yield and quality of planted crops. The invention relates to a fertilizer containing microorganisms and organic matter. Background technique
[0002] Fertilizer production is very important to China's agricultural development. Chinese agriculture has used chemical fertilizers for many years. Generally speaking, chemical fertilizers mainly contain nitrogen, phosphorus, and potassium to supplement the lost nutrients for the soil, thereby increasing the total output of crops. However, in recent years, the utilization rate of chemical fertilizers has been declining, and the yield of crops is not as good as before. Embodiment Construction
[0010] The invention relates to an organic fertilizer containing microorganisms, which is characterized in that it consists of microorganism populations and organic matter.
[0011] The microbial population includes yeast, actinomycetes, photosynthetic bacteria, nitrogen-fixing bacteria, phosphorus and potassium solubilizing bacteria. Each gram of fertilizer contains 20 million effective viable bacteria.
[0012] The organic matter is derived from livestock and poultry manure, wood chaff, distiller's grains, dried oranges, brown sugar, raw flour, vermicelli residue, peanuts, and peanut shells. Organic matter accounts for 42 percent by weight of fertilizer.
[0013] The nutrient comes from livestock and poultry manure, wood chaff, distiller's grains, dried oranges, brown sugar, raw flour, vermicelli residue, peanuts, and peanut shells. Total nutrients account for 6 percent by weight of fertilizer.
